bellygothposting for melanie. I just got off the phone with Mel an here is the latest news:
They are ok and armed and defending the bar. They plan on staying at the bar until the police make them leave or until the situation with the electricity looks too bleak. The quarter isn't flooding yet and so far they still have gas at the bar so they've been cooking what perishables they have left. Official Search and Rescue Center at the Louisiana Office of Emergency Preparedness
225-925-7708 or 7709 or 3511 or 7428 i.e. 225-925-3511
If you have friends or family that are stuck in NOLA and the surrounding areas this is the official number to call. Be prepared to try to call several times... everyone is calling these numbers.
If you can contact your friends get the exact address of where they are at or where they are going to be for when you call search and rescue. tell them if they have to leave to call you asap. You can update the OEP at commo1@ohsep.louisiana.gov
Cell phone communication is extremely limited, but Text messaging on Verizon, Cingular and Sprint networks appear to be working.
If you get in touch with your friends they need to do the following
1) They need a white sheet on the roof of a building
2) They need to wave something to notify the helicopter that they need to be rescued.
3) If it is at night they need to use flash lights to signal the helicopter.
4) They need to stay at the highest point.
